A charming port city in the heart of Patagonia, serving as the gateway to the world-renowned Torres del Paine National Park. It is famous for its stunning fjord, glacial landscapes, and outdoor adventures.

Visa Information

Most nationalities, including those from the US, Canada, UK, and EU, can enter Chile visa-free for up to 90 days for tourism.

Getting Around

The town of Puerto Natales is small and easily navigable on foot. To get to Torres del Paine National Park and surrounding areas, buses, organized tours, and rental cars are available. It's recommended to book transport in advance, especially during peak season.

Local Flavors

Patagonian cuisine is famous for its high-quality lamb, often slow-roasted over a fire (asado al palo). King crab (centolla) and local seafood are also must-try delicacies. The town has numerous restaurants offering everything from traditional Chilean dishes to international cuisine.
